Job description

The role:

  • Perform a range of activities relating to compliance with the End-of-Life Choices (Voluntary Assisted Dying) Act 2021 including monitoring and assessing compliance and assisting with special investigations into suspected contraventions of the legislation.
  • Prepare high quality comprehensive, accurate, authoritative, and timely documentation required for, or related to, the End-of-Life Choices (Voluntary Assisted Dying) Act 2021’s operation in Tasmania, including statutory instruments, minutes and briefings, meeting agendas and meeting minutes, presentations, correspondence, and fact sheets.
  • Provide high level and authoritative advice, expertise, and assistance to the Manager - Office of the VAD Commission, members of the VAD Commission, other senior managers, and other relevant stakeholders on compliance, education, and associated matters concerning voluntary assisted dying and the operation of the End-of-Life Choices (Voluntary Assisted Dying) Act 2021 in Tasmania.
  • Perform a range of activities required to support the operation of the VAD Commission including providing high level Executive Support to members of the VAD Commission, and to other senior managers and developing, coordinating, integrating, and maintaining diverse and varied administrative practices and systems, policies and protocols to support the work of the Voluntary Assisted Dying Commission and the Commission’s records management and Executive Support needs.

The Head of the State Service has determined that the person nominated for this job is to satisfy a pre‑employment check before taking up the appointment, on promotion or transfer. The following checks are to be conducted:

  1. Conviction checks in the following areas:
  1. crimes of violence
  2. sex related offences
  3. serious drug offences
  4. crimes involving dishonesty
  1. Identification check
  2. Disciplinary action in previous employment check.
